Output 10b24b49e5bd1b32c36e471f7816759cb642d34d5472e6c465d147728d01f22d:4

value
2332300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800e17c29ec24106bf6906b64e65f5204fdd0c4a OP_EQUAL
address
3DN7JHRG1zf5ebBbp5MhtKmPWyVNo8Tqgh
transaction
10b24b49e5bd1b32c36e471f7816759cb642d34d5472e6c465d147728d01f22d
confirmations
389317
spent
true